Permis de séjour pour étudiants non européens admis dans un établissement reconnu en Italie, en vertu de la directive européenne sur les étudiants et les chercheurs. Permet généralement un travail à temps partiel limité et une période de recherche d'emploi après les études.
Les étudiants non européens séjournant plus de 90 jours ont besoin d'un visa d'étudiant national, puis demandent un permis de séjour pour motifs de studio dans les 8 jours ouvrables suivant leur arrivée. Le permis permet un travail à temps partiel limité et peut souvent être converti en permis de travail en dehors du quota.

Under Law 74/2025, recognition is generally limited to people with a parent or grandparent who was born in Italy, replacing the previous unlimited generational chain.
Non-EU nationals generally need ten years of legal residence in Italy, while EU citizens generally need four years, and these periods are shorter for some special categories.
